 Q  How do you think we ended up in this economic situation in the country?

 

 ANS  Since this government came on board what they keep saying is that, the last administration squandered all the resources of the country, later they will say it is 24 or 27billion they found in the Reserves. They keep giving us contradictory statement about Nigeria financial state. The CBN Governor at a point told us we have 24.7billion dollars in Reserves, the following day the President said he almost ran away because he met empty treasury. Though recently we had the foreign reserves has grown to about 30billion dollars but the amount they met is not even the issue. If I have a company and I noticed the company is not doing very well and I decided to change the MD, what I expect from him is to turn around the fortune of the company not complain about the past because I already know, that was why I made the changes in the first place. As at the time this government came into power, I will not say there was no corruption, I agree, even the present government of APC is corrupt. But you must separate corruption from development, Chief Obasanjo is a living example to that. Tell me what Obasanjo met in the coffers when he came in 1999, less than 4billion naira and with over 60billion IMF loan. He was able to clear the debt either by debt relief or payment and left about 45billion in the coffers of the government. What he did then was simple, he knew Nigeria has economic problem and our image in the international community was bad. As soon as he was sworn in, he left the country for World Bank to request for Nigerians that are working there, that understand how to reposition the economy. He employed them, the likes of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ala, Prof Charles Soludo, I also know he went to United Nations to bring Ambassador Adeniji to come and be our Foreign Affairs Minister. With Adeniji’s influence in international community, our image was revived, it was from there we got the debt relief, the debt relief even cut across other West Africans Nations. It was at that period he sent a bill to establish EFCC and ICPC to fight corruption. However, he didn’t allow the anti corruption drive to hinder economic development, the two policies were working without hindering one another. Go and check the record of Obasanjo anti corruption drive and compare to what we have today. Though what we were made to believe is that there is no corrupt person in APC however the moment any corrupt politician from another party cross to APC it’s like entering a safe heaven ,we have seen series of example like that. The case of the SGF is still fresh, awarding a contract to himself by proxy, we all hear what the Presidency says about it. You can imagine if he was in another Party. The case of former Governor of Abia is similar, also Senator Joshua Dariye, its just a case of selective justices or fighting perceived enemies to the best of my knowledge.

 

 Q  What is your take about the government approach to the economy?

 

 ANS  They took the wrong step when they came in, they brought in bad policies via try and error that has been the bane of the economic situation we are. It was wrong for the government to stop payment into domiciliary account or withdrawing from it, that singular act causes a lot of panic in the system. A lot of investors took their money and left the country. Secondly, inability to be able to put up cabinet within 6month is another major problems,am of the opinion that even before pmb won the election, he should have  an idea of those that will work with him.Equally he stopped the amnesty program because of corruption, shutdown the Maritime University, payment for Ex-militant given scholarship were stopped. This were programs of his predecessor to curb militancy in the area, all these steps affected the economy. My opinion is that the President should be able to separate corruption from the amnesty program via bio-metrics to determine the authentic number of people that are entitled for the programs and let it go ahead, and then bring the corrupt officials to book by so doing, we won’t have problem as much as we are having in the Niger-Delta. Our crude Oil fell from 2.2million production to less than 800,000 barrel sometimes with a short fall of about 1.4M barrels meaning we are losing close to 100m dollar daily
